Understanding .tar.gz Files

Before diving into the extraction process, let’s understand what .tar.gz files are and why they’re so popular.

  • Tar: Stands for “Tape Archive.” It’s a format used to bundle multiple files and directories into a single archive.
  • Gz: Represents “gzip,” a compression algorithm that shrinks the size of the tar archive, making it more efficient to store and transmit.

Essentially, a .tar.gz file is like a zipped folder containing multiple files and folders, all compressed together for easy handling.

Essential Tools for the Job

To extract .tar.gz files in Windows, you’ll need a reliable tool that understands both the tar and gzip formats. Here are a few popular options:

1. 7-Zip: A free and open-source file archiver that supports a wide range of archive formats, including tar.gz. It’s known for its speed and efficiency.

2. WinRAR: Another popular choice, WinRAR is a powerful file archiver available as a paid software. It offers advanced features and excellent compatibility with various archive formats.

3. PeaZip: This free and open-source file archiver is a great alternative to 7-Zip and WinRAR. It supports a wide range of archiving formats, including tar.gz, and offers a user-friendly interface.

Step-by-Step Guide to Extracting .tar.gz Files

Now, let’s walk through the extraction process using 7-Zip, as it’s a widely available and free option.

1. Download and Install 7-Zip: If you haven’t already, download 7-Zip from their official website ([https://www.7-zip.org/](https://www.7-zip.org/)). Install it on your Windows system.

2. Locate the .tar.gz File: Find the .tar.gz file you want to extract on your computer.

3. Right-Click the File: Right-click on the .tar.gz file and select “7-Zip” from the context menu.

4. Choose “Extract to…”: From the 7-Zip menu, select “Extract to…”

5. Select a Destination Folder: Browse to the location where you want to extract the files and click “OK.”

6. Extraction Process: 7-Zip will begin extracting the files from the archive. This may take a few minutes depending on the size of the archive.

7. Access the Extracted Files: Once the extraction is complete, you’ll find the extracted files and folders in the destination folder you selected.

Tips for Handling .tar.gz Files

  • Verify File Integrity: Before extracting a .tar.gz file, it’s a good practice to verify its integrity using a checksum tool. This ensures that the file hasn’t been corrupted during download or transfer.
  • Check for Viruses: Always scan any downloaded .tar.gz file for viruses before extracting it.
  • Understand File Structure: Familiarize yourself with the structure of the extracted files and folders to navigate the contents effectively.

2. What if the extraction process fails?

If the extraction fails, it could be due to a corrupted file, insufficient disk space, or an issue with the extraction tool. Try re-downloading the file, ensuring enough disk space, or using a different extraction tool.

5. What are some common uses of .tar.gz files?

.tar.gz files are commonly used for distributing software packages, storing large datasets, and backing up data. They offer a convenient way to bundle and compress multiple files for efficient storage and transfer.
